Primitive Methodist Chapel in Cornhill, Radnorshire, was built in the early 19th century by members of the Primitive Methodist movement, a religious revival within Methodism. The chapel reflects the nonconformist tradition of the period and is significant as a local place of worship that supported the growing Methodist community in rural Wales.
